Thiruvantapuram or Trivandrum is Kerala's gracious capital city
with its palaces, museums and the beautiful bech resort of kovalam.
Dominating the city is the Padmanabhaswamy temple with its tall
gopurams or gateways. Built in the Dravidian style, the temple has
within its sactum an immense image of the Lord Vishnu reclining on
the coils of the sacred serpent Ananta. Thiruvantapuram derives the
name from this patron diety.

Hyderabad the city is known for its laid back refined lifestyle,
its legendary, cuisine and its beautiful palaces monuments and
museums. It is a unique blend of the north and the south India.
Among the places of interest Charminar - the city symbol has four
minarets that is why the name, mecca Masjid - One of the
grandest mosques built, Salarjung museum - houses the single largest
collection ever made by one man, Mir Yusuf Jung - Prime Minister to
Nizam of Hyderabad, Sri Venkateswara Temple, Faluknuma Palace - A
grand Palace, Hussian Sagar - Hyderbad's Largest Lake and Golconda
Fort.

Pondicherry was a french dream of an indian empire which began and
ended here.The french connection, the serene atmosphere of urban
Pondicherry influened by the Aurbindo Ashram and the lovely beach combine
to make pondicherry a fascinating destination. Pondicherry has been
influenced by the french over along time from 1673 to 1954, when it merged
with rest of India.
It is aunique Indian town , oval shaped and clean, alovely beach
etc.Afternooon sightseeing tour of the city to include Auroville - a
town of tomorrow that's now in making , symbolising an experiment in
international living, it was launched in 1968 with co-operation of
many nations.Matamandir, the meditation hall, is the heart of the
town.It is sorrounded by 800 acres of land, barren in parts with
only 1000 residents.They live in14 different commounes and speak 55
diffrent languages. Also visit Aurobindo Ashram, Museum,
Botanical garden, Boat house and the Handmade Paper Industry.
